reminder for anyone that the 170 price tag is the starter: you have to buy batteries if you want handheld, plus you have to buy a dtap cord, plus the handle... plus buying a lightbox. etc. i ended up spending about 300 for my 60x, plus batteries and 45x45. havent bought the handle yet cuz it's a month behind ;( still a great price for what you get of course, but be aware

@@kylemeshna I was really interested in these at first, but I'm worried they're not bright enough. Would these be good enough for indoors with a lightbox? Or should I just go with the 100?
@@conservovirtus5796 It's a bit dependent on what you need it for? Are you just lighting a RU-vid video in a smaller space? If so, then you'll be totally fine. but if you needed something for a bigger production or want something to blast through a window to simulate sunlight, then you'll want more power.
